When you edit an issue's description on the task's page (eg. https://project.atlassian.net/browse/ID-001) and you want to save your changes, so you press Ctrl+S which brings up the save dialog in the latest Chrome. Ok, that's not you wanted, so you press the Escape button and you've lost your changes. It's very counterintuitive.
Suggestions:
- map Ctrl+S to save changes
- or if the user made changes don't discard them without any warning
- (not prefered) or somehow block save dialog Esc to discard the changes
